WebAug 13, 2024 · Hard-Shell, Quahog, and Round. Hard-shell clams ( Mercenaria mercenaria) go by many names. Littlenecks, topnecks, cherrystones, chowders—they are all the same clam, just different sizes (listed from smallest to biggest). They live in the Atlantic Ocean along the east coasts of the U.S. and Canada in intertidal areas burrowed in the sand. WebRazor clams are large, meaty, sweet-tasting clams that are prized by clam diggers. They have a relatively restricted range – 95 percent of all razor clams are harvested from 18 miles of beach in Clatsop County.
